Current jobs related to C++ Linux Senior Software Engineer - Bengaluru - Talent500


  • Bengaluru, Karnataka, India TECELF Full time

    Job Title: C Linux Software EngineerOverview: At TECELF, we are seeking a skilled C Linux Software Engineer to join our team. As a critical member of our organization, you will play a pivotal role in developing and maintaining C applications on the Linux platform.Key Responsibilities:Design and develop C applications for Linux-based systemsCollaborate with...


  • Bengaluru, Karnataka, India TECELF Full time

    Job Summary:We are seeking a highly skilled C Linux Software Engineer to join our team at TECELF. The successful candidate will be responsible for designing and developing C applications for Linux-based systems, collaborating with cross-functional teams to define design and ship new features, and optimizing application performance and ensuring...


  • Bengaluru, Karnataka, India TECELF Full time

    Job Summary:We are seeking a highly skilled C Linux Software Engineer to join our team at TECELF. The successful candidate will be responsible for developing and maintaining C applications on the Linux platform.Key Responsibilities:Design and Develop: C applications for Linux-based systems, ensuring stability, performance, and security.Collaborate: With...


  • Bengaluru, Karnataka, India TECELF Full time

    Job Title:Senior C Linux DeveloperJob Summary:TECELF is seeking a highly skilled Senior C Linux Developer to join our team. As a Senior C Linux Developer, you will be responsible for developing and maintaining C applications on the Linux platform.Key Responsibilities:Design and Develop: C applications for Linux-based systemsCollaborate: with cross-functional...


  • Bengaluru, Karnataka, India Cisco Full time

    About the Role:Cisco is seeking a highly skilled Senior Software Engineer to join our Unified Computing Systems (UCS) team in the Data Center space. As a key member of our team, you will be responsible for designing and developing UCS Server system management firmware and management utilities software.Key Responsibilities:Design and develop software using...


  • Bengaluru, Karnataka, India Lufthansa Technik Services India Private Limited Full time

    Job Title: Senior Linux System Software EngineerLufthansa Technik Services India Private Limited is seeking a highly skilled Senior Linux System Software Engineer to join our team.Key Responsibilities:Design, develop, and maintain system-level software in Linux environments.Write and optimize C/C++ code for performance and scalability.Collaborate with...


  • Bengaluru, Karnataka, India Areteminds Technologies Full time

    Job Title: Senior C# Software EngineerJob Description:We are seeking a highly skilled Senior C# Software Engineer to join our team at Areteminds Technologies. As a Senior C# Software Engineer, you will be responsible for developing and maintaining software applications using C# on Windows and Linux operating systems.Key Responsibilities:Write efficient code...


  • Bengaluru, Karnataka, India Aptiv Full time

    About the RoleAptiv is seeking a skilled Senior Software Engineer to join our team, specializing in C++ Linux Development. This role involves developing software that rewrites the rules of transportation safety, eco-friendliness, and connectivity.Your ResponsibilitiesAnalyzing customer requirements and converting them into design and code.Developing code in...


  • Bengaluru, Karnataka, India Cisco Full time

    About the Role:Cisco is seeking an experienced Senior Software Engineer to join our Unified Computing Systems (UCS) team, working in the Data Center space. The ideal candidate will have a strong background in C programming, Linux operating systems, and BMC expertise.About the Team:You will be working closely with our product management and technical...


  • Bengaluru, Karnataka, India TECELF Full time

    Job Title: C Linux Software DeveloperWe are seeking a highly skilled C Linux Software Developer to join our team at TECELF. As a key member of our software development team, you will play a critical role in designing, developing, and maintaining C applications on the Linux platform.Key Responsibilities:Design and develop C applications for Linux-based...


  • Bengaluru, Karnataka, India KPIT Full time

    Job DescriptionWe are seeking a highly skilled Senior C++ Software Engineer with expertise in modern C++ development and experience in Adaptive Autosar platform/embedded platform.Key ResponsibilitiesDesign, develop, and test high-quality software using C++11 and C++14.Collaborate with cross-functional teams to drive software design and development.Implement...


  • Bengaluru, Karnataka, India LTIMindtree Full time

    Job Title: Senior C Software EngineerWe are seeking a highly skilled Senior C Software Engineer to join our team at LTIMindtree. The ideal candidate will have a strong background in C programming, Linux kernel development, and operating systems.Key Responsibilities:Design, develop, and troubleshoot software programs for enhancements.Develop strong...


  • Bengaluru, Karnataka, India Capgemini Engineering Full time

    Job DescriptionWe are seeking a highly skilled C++ Linux Software Developer to join our team at Capgemini Engineering.Key Responsibilities:Design and develop high-quality C++ software for Linux platforms.Collaborate with cross-functional teams to identify and prioritize software development projects.Implement and maintain Unix/Linux software development...


  • Bengaluru, Karnataka, India TECELF Full time

    Job Summary:We are seeking a highly skilled C Linux Developer to join our team at TECELF. The successful candidate will be responsible for designing and developing C applications for Linux-based systems, collaborating with cross-functional teams to define design and ship new features, and ensuring the stability, performance, and security of software...


  • Bengaluru, Karnataka, India Cisco Full time

    About the Role:Cisco is seeking a Senior Software Engineer with 8+ years of experience to join our Unified Computing Systems (UCS) team in the Data Center space. The ideal candidate will have expertise in C programming, Linux operating system, and BMC. This is an excellent opportunity to work on the design and development of UCS Server system management...


  • Bengaluru, Karnataka, India Thales Full time

    Thales Software Development OpportunityAs a Senior Software Architect with Thales, you will be a key member of our software development team, responsible for designing and implementing embedded software solutions using C and C++ programming languages. Your strong analytical and problem-solving skills will be essential in ensuring timely delivery of...


  • Bengaluru, Karnataka, India NR Consulting - India Full time

    Job Title: Senior C++ Software EngineerJob Summary:NR Consulting - India is seeking a highly skilled Senior C++ Software Engineer to join our team. The ideal candidate will have a strong background in C++ programming and software design, with experience in designing and maintaining software applications, managing GCC versions, and writing RPM spec files.Key...


  • Bengaluru, Karnataka, India TekIT Software Solutions Full time

    C++ Developer Job DescriptionWe are seeking a highly skilled C++ Developer to join our team at TekIT Software Solutions. The ideal candidate will have a strong background in C++ programming, with experience in developing display software features and improving existing software through factoring.Key Responsibilities:Design and implement display software...


  • Bengaluru, Karnataka, India Cisco Full time

    About the Role:This is an exciting opportunity to join the Cisco team working on the company's Data Center space. The Cisco UCS Rack Server is a cutting-edge, high-density server optimized for performance and efficiency, making it suitable for various applications such as virtualization and bare-metal workloads.Your Responsibilities:Design and develop UCS...


  • Bengaluru, Karnataka, India Stixis Technologies Full time

    Job Description for Senior Software DeveloperC++, C#, Linux, TCP/IP, Http, JavaScript, Html, CSS - (Mandatory skills required)We are looking for a highly skilled software developer to join our team at Stixis Technologies.Key Responsibilities:Design and develop software applications using C++ and Linux.Collaborate with cross-functional teams to identify and...

C++ Linux Senior Software Engineer

3 months ago


Bengaluru, India Talent500 Full time

Role: C++ Linux Senior Software Engineer


Function: IT


Sub function: Engineering


Executive: CIO organization


Responsibilities:

  • Application Ownership: Take full ownership of an existing core application, ensuring its continuous performance, stability, and scalability.
  • Development and Maintenance: Develop, maintain, and optimize software components primarily in C++ on a Linux platform.
  • IoT and RFID Systems: Work on signal collection and processing systems for IoT and RFID technologies.
  • Device Emulator: Contribute to the development and enhancement of our device emulator.
  • Event Routing: Implement and manage the event (publish/subscribe) router for data communication.
  • Node.js/V8 Integration: Collaborate on integrating Node.js/V8 for enhancing functionality.
  • ALE: Work with Application-Level Events (ALE) for RFID and sensor devices.
  • Device Management and DRM: Develop and manage device management protocols and Digital Rights Management (DRM) systems.
  • Device Abstraction: Work on device abstraction layers to ensure compatibility across various hardware and software interfaces.


Must Have Skills:

  • Strong proficiency in C++ programming.
  • Extensive experience with Linux operating systems.
  • Familiarity with IoT and RFID technologies.
  • Knowledge of Node.js / V8, ODBC, and ALE.
  • Experience with device management and DRM systems.
  • Understanding of event-driven architectures, particularly publish/subscribe models.


Nice to Have Skills:

  • Experience with device emulators and device abstraction layers.
  • Knowledge of hardware interfaces and embedded systems.
  • Familiarity with Agile development methodologies.
  • Experience in git SCM
  • Experience in Azure DevOps
  • Experience in Oracle 19c and/or similar RDBMS Schema/SQL design
  • Experience with cloud technologies such as Azure or AWS Cloud Platform
  • Shows good aptitude in understanding business operations workflow analysis
  • Strong communication and collaboration skills


Years Experience: 5+